On 06/03/10 05:07, Simon Geard wrote:
> Why set up wireless network connections by hand, for example, when
> NetworkManager lets you simply pick an access point from a list?

Because if I set it up by hand I can put the commands in a script and never 
need to
think of it again. wpa_supplicant is a very flexible tool. I've configured it 
to know
the password to several wireless networks and will automatically connect to 
whichever
one it can see.
